Output ffef99af9641d6384774bddcfc8bdf6ef8bde754b20bbc09385e5889b8e5676c:1

value
1084041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 752129699985c12b54afee367e7f53dcdbd98852 OP_EQUAL
address
3CNLi7DHj2G91spvTbiUE3xn1rLtoErFv1
transaction
ffef99af9641d6384774bddcfc8bdf6ef8bde754b20bbc09385e5889b8e5676c
confirmations
155317
spent
true